For the 2024 school year, there are 3 public elementary schools serving 782 students in Center For Academic Success Inc. (4191) School District. This district's average elementary testing ranking is 6/10, which is in the top 50% of public elementary schools in Arizona.
Public Elementary Schools in Center For Academic Success Inc. (4191) School District have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the Arizona public elementary school average of 32%), and reading proficiency score of 43% (versus the 40%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 79%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Arizona public elementary school average of 65%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$11,522 is higher than the state median of $11,274. The school district revenue/student has grown by 20%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$11,403 is higher than the state median of $11,177.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
